    Juvenile hormone I is the principal juvenile hormone in a hemipteran insect, Riptortus clavatus

    Juvenile hormone I (JH I) was identified by combined gas chromatography/mass spectrometry as the predominant JH in the hemolymph of female adults of the bean bug,Riptortus clavatus (Thunberg) (Hemiptera: Alydidae...
